SUPVAN E12 Bluetooth Label Maker: 4 Tapes, App & Keyboard, 30+ Fonts, 660+ Icons
Product description
What this is and what it solves
The SUPVAN E12 is a rechargeable, inkless label maker designed for quick, organized labeling across office, home, kitchen, school and classroom settings. It combines a physical keyboard for fast, frequent labeling and a Bluetooth-connected app for design flexibility. If you want clean, legible labels without swapping batteries or cords, this device aims to streamline everyday organization.
How it works in practice

Print directly from the built-in keyboard for fast notes and tags, or connect via Bluetooth to the companion app to customize layouts with more than 30 fonts, 50 frames and 660 icons. The system supports local templates and multiple languages (17 languages supported), letting you save your designs for repeated use. The LCD screen is backlit, so you can read labels clearly whether you’re under bright office lights or dim pantry shelves.
What stands out on paper
A notable efficiency feature is the minimal 0.2" printing margin, meaning tighter labels and better material usage versus typical label makers. The 1200mAh internal battery promises up to a month between charges, which is convenient for busy desks and schools where swapping batteries is a nuisance.

Quick FAQ
- Does it print without the app? Yes, you can print directly via the built-in keyboard.
- How many languages are supported? The device supports 17 languages in its built-in system.
- Can I save my templates locally? Yes, you can create and save templates on the device.
- What’s the benefit of the 0.2" margin? It reduces material use and increases label density, helping you fit more information on each label.
